- #!/usr/bin/env python2
- import sys, os, os.path
- import pywii as wii
- wii.loadkeys()
- def parseint(d):
- if len(d) > 2 and d[0:2].lower()=='0x':
- return int(d,16)
- return int(d)
- if len(sys.argv) < 4 or len(sys.argv) > 7:
- print "Usage:"
- print " python %s <encrypted ISO> <partition number> <file to extract to> [Partition offset] [length]"%sys.argv[0]
- sys.exit(1)
- iso_name, partno, data_name = sys.argv[1:4]
- partno = int(partno)
- part_offset = 0
- data_offset = 0
- copy_length = None
- if len(sys.argv) >= 5:
- part_offset = parseint(sys.argv[4])
- if len(sys.argv) == 6:
- copy_length = parseint(sys.argv[5])
- if copy_length is not None and copy_length < 0:
- print "Error: negative copy length"
- sys.exit(1)
- disc = wii.WiiDisc(iso_name)
- disc.showinfo()
- part = wii.WiiCachedPartition(disc, partno, cachesize=32, debug=False, checkhash=False)
- if part_offset >= part.data_bytes:
- print "Error: Offset past end of partition"
- sys.exit(1)
- if copy_length is None:
- copy_length = part.data_bytes - part_offset
- if copy_length > (part.data_bytes - part_offset):
- print "Error: Length too large"
- sys.exit(1)
-
- dataf = open(data_name, "wb")
- left = copy_length
- offset = part_offset
- while left > 0:
- blocklen = min(left, 4*1024*1024)
- d = part.read(offset, blocklen)
- if len(d) != blocklen:
- print "Part EOF reached!"
- sys.exit(1)
- dataf.write(d)
- offset += blocklen
- left -= blocklen
- dataf.close()
